Take it to a friggin' mechanic and have it thoroughly checked out!

Any car with higher mileage is going to be heading toward "maintenance city" once it reaches a certain point, so yes, you will be due for a brake change, fluid changes, and other possible mechanical work. But at the same time, any used car can be a great purchase if it's been taken car of and if you follow-up with routine maintenance.

As for the cars you've looked at, you've been all over the board as far as types of cars and years.

Your best bet if needing something reliable and that will last during your college years is something as new as possible and affordable.

So I'd look at cars like the RSX Type S, WRX, Scion tC, Acura Integra GSR, Celica GTS, a newer S2K (02-03), or something else that has been reliable over the years and that you can get fairly new and with low mileage.

Your dad does have some good points. At that mileage you start getting into some preventative maintenance windows that may cost some cash. That's NOT to say the S is unreliable. All cars need to have some major preventative maintenance to keep them in proper form. The only way to put that off is to

a) NOT do the maintenance (bad idea), or
b) buy a lower mileage car.

I would try to get a lower mileage car, especially if I drove to school back and forth every day. Then again, I'm getting old and cautious...what do I know!? LOL.
